Abstract: A luggage bin assembly adapted to be disposed within a vehicle. The luggage bin assembly includes a bin (203) reciprocally mounted for movement between an opened position and a closed position. The luggage bin assembly also includes a linkage assembly (232) adapted to be hingedly mounted to the bin for swinging movement with the bin as the bin is reciprocated between the open and closed positions. A reciprocating assist mechanism (216) is coupled to the linkage mechanism to selectively apply an assist load to the linkage assembly when the bin is reciprocated between the opened and closed positions.
